Neil began his early career as an illustrator and graphic artist working in print, publishing, and new media. From illustrating product catalogues to producing maps and diagrams during the Gulf War, he worked in a range of media and quickly embraced the wave of computer technology as it spread into the graphic art industry.

Having spent many years as a designer for traditional media, retail packaging, and then the internet from the mid 90′s, work has, in recent years, involved increasingly technical disciplines, designing content management solutions and online applications.

But the siren song of a more creative life has broken the surface and since 2008, Neil has turned to less commercial work, rediscovering the technical, enhanced realism styles in which he once illustrated, but also exploring new paths with abstract art in 2009.

In October 2009, Neil was accepted as an Associate Member of the Society for Graphic Fine Art, a small, select membership organisation created in 1919 to promote drawing and draftsmanship in art.

This website presents a broad spectrum of work from the precise, detailed pencil works, to expressive drawings in charcoal and mixed media, as well as explorations of abstract imagery with works in watercolour, mixed media, and acrylic.

Neil cites his inspirations as Picasso, Miró and Dalí to more contemporary artists such as Katy Moran, Cy Twombly, and Jenny Saville, though such influences are not immediately apparent in most of his work.
